Can't help with the JSA but with the dentists what you need is a HC1 or HC2 or HC3 certificate.

 

Read this http://www.adviceguide.org.uk/index/your_family/health/help_with_health_costs.htm as it explains all about benefits/low income and help with costs.

 

Even if you are on contribution based benefits you can still qualify for free treatment (or partial help with costs).

Call them again and explain that you had a three hour callback which didn't happen. This should be logged and they should then try and get this callback done much quicker.

 

It isn't fobbing off, it's just not a perfect system and sometimes people in the queue get missed.

Link to post
Share on other sites

Did you take the name of the person or people you spoke to? If so, ask to speak to the Centre Manager and make a complaint. I take it that if there is no money in your account tomorrow, that you will be ringing JCP to find out. If you are told again that they do not understand why you have not been paid ask them to look in the Jobseeker Allowance Payment System (Jsaps). If you are told that they will ring you in 3 hours and nobody calls. Remember to take the persons name and ring him/her back. Then politely but directly ask him/her to explain to you their (JCP) customer charter.
